Olympic Games Performance
The team's journey in the Olympic Games is marked by a high frequency of podium finishes. Their gold medal streak spanned several decades, demonstrating an ability to adapt to the evolving nature of the game.
The team earned Gold medals in 1968, 1972, 1980, and 1988. They also secured Silver medals in 1964, 1976, and later as part of the Unified Team (a joint team of former Soviet republics) in 1992.

The FIVB (Fédération Internationale de Volleyball) World Championship is one of the most grueling tests of a team's strength. The team displayed early dominance with three consecutive Gold medals from 1952 to 1960, eventually adding more titles in 1970 and 1990.
In the FIVB World Cup, the team achieved its highest honor with a Gold medal in 1973. They remained competitive throughout the 1980s and early 90s, collecting three Bronze medals (1981, 1985, 1991) and one Silver medal in 1989.

The European Championship served as the team's most successful arena. Their record here is characterized by an extraordinary run of Gold medals, particularly between 1949 and 1991.
The team captured 12 Gold medals, including a remarkable streak of titles in the 1960s and 70s. Their consistency was further highlighted by several Silver medal finishes in 1955, 1981, 1983, and 1987.
